FIELD OF DREAMS: REMASTERED/EXPANDED LIMITED EDITION (2-CD SET) LLLCD 1572 Music by James Horner Limited Edition of 5000 Units RETAIL PRICE: $29.98 STARTS SHIPPING JAN 7 La-La Land Records, Universal Pictures and Sony Music proudly present a limited edition, remastered and expanded 2-CD release of legendary composer James Horner’s (STAR TREK II – THE WRATH OF KHAN, GLORY, TITANIC) original motion picture score to the timeless 1989 baseball-themed drama FIELD OF DREAMS, starring Kevin Costner, James Earl Jones and Ray Liotta, and directed by Phil Alden Robinson. Maestro Horner’s score to this classic film is a pitch-perfect work that expertly blends synth and orchestra to create a beautiful and deeply-felt tapestry tinged with Americana. Horner’s home run of a score gets the deluxe treatment with this limited edition reissue, remastered from the original digital tapes and expanded with previously unreleased music. Disc One features the expanded original soundtrack, while Disc Two presents the re-mastered 1989 Original Soundtrack Album. Produced by Mike Matessino and Neil S. Bulk and mastered by Matessino, this 2-CD release is limited to 5000 units and includes exclusive, in-depth liner notes by writer Jeff Bond and art design by Jim Titus.
